Same wheel model as the one I just worked on, but a different case.
DSC01032amx4.jpg
DSC01031amx4.jpg
Both front and rear had about a sheet of paper's worth of center offset.
It's within manufacturer shipping standards, so not really a problem.
(Though I'll fix it anyway)

It's been about two years with no maintenance,
so the customer couldn't pinpoint what's wrong and just wanted me to take a look.
The runout was minor.
But the rear wheel spoke tension was noticeably slack,
so I've been tightening them up.
I did the same thing in the previous post,
but the amount of retensioning here was way more.
I had the customer feel the spokes before and after,
and there was a clear difference in tightness.
I think they'll probably notice it when they actually ride it.
Though there might be some placebo effect since they know beforehand that I retensioned them.
